The soybean market is holding firm as traders wait for South America’s production numbers. Total Farm Marketing Senior Market Advisor Naomi Blohm says there is a lot of uncertainty for traders. “I don’t know how much higher soybeans can go, but at the same time, if this crop is getting smaller in South America, Holy cow, this market has a long way to go.” The trade is looking at every forecast to determine crop conditions. “I don’t think they do a crop tour like we do here in the United States. Getting information out of South America is tricky at times and it will be a volatile market until we know more.”
